Weber's Spirit line has received notable upgrades, making it a standout among gas grills. The new models can reach temperatures exceeding 800℉, enabling proper searing of foods. The introduction of Snap-Jet ignition allows for easy one-handed lighting of individual burners without the common frustrations of push-button starters. The design of the Spirit grill is substantial, featuring heavy cast iron grates that facilitate cooking and easy mobility through functional casters. Overall, these improvements elevate the gas grilling experience beyond traditional expectations.
